Detailed Description
Referring to fig. 1-5, a continuous sewage treatment device applied to rural water environment treatment comprises a filter box 1, wherein a cover plate 2 is inserted into the upper surface of the filter box 1, a water inlet pipe 3 for conveying sewage into the filter box 1 is fixedly communicated with the upper surface of the cover plate 2, and an inclined grid 4 is fixedly installed on the inner wall of the filter box 1 through bolts;
the front of rose box 1 is provided with rubbish circulation collection device, and rubbish circulation collection device includes driving motor 5, drive belt 6 and scraper blade 7, driving motor 5 drive 6 rotations of drive belt drive scraper blade 7 is right the rubbish that 4 surfaces of grid are detained realizes the clearance action.
Further, a driving motor 5 is fixedly installed on the front surface of the filter box 1, a driving rod 8 and a driven rod 9 which extend through the interior of the filter box 1 are respectively installed on the front surface of the filter box 1 through bearings, an output shaft of the driving motor 5 is fixedly connected with one end of the driving rod 8 through a coupler, and a driving belt pulley 10 is fixedly connected to the outer surface of the driving rod 8 located in the filter box 1; through above-mentioned technical scheme, in order to carry out automatic clearance to 4 surperficial floaters of grid better, so, all adopt the tilting installation with grid 4, driving lever 8 and driven lever 9, drive belt 6 by driving motor 5 and rotate, drive scraper blade 7 carries out the propelling movement to the rubbish that the grid 4 surface is detained by the oblique top down.
Further, a driven pulley 11 is fixedly connected to the outer surface of the driven rod 9 in the filter box 1, the driving pulley 10 and the driven pulley 11 are driven by a transmission belt 6, the scraper 7 is fixedly installed on the outer surface of the transmission belt 6, and the lower surface of the scraper 7 is in contact with the upper surface of the grating 4; through above-mentioned technical scheme, drive belt 6 and scraper blade 7 cooperation are used, and drive belt 6 drives scraper blade 7 when the pivoted and realizes automatic propelling movement to the floater on grid 4 surface.
Further, a garbage collection box 12 is arranged on the left side surface of the filter box 1, a discharge hole 13 is arranged on the inner wall of one side of the filter box 1 close to the garbage collection box 12, and the inner wall of the discharge hole 13 is inclined; through above-mentioned technical scheme, set up discharge hole 13 and concentrate the collection to the rubbish of scraper blade 7 propelling movement.
Further, the inner wall of the garbage collection box 12 is fixedly connected with a placing block 14, and the upper surface of the placing block 14 is clamped with a net-shaped draining plate 15; place piece 14 and 15 cooperations of waterlogging caused by excessive rainfall board and use, conveniently wash waterlogging caused by excessive rainfall board 15, set up waterlogging caused by excessive rainfall board 15 and play the effect of realizing the driping to rubbish.
Furthermore, a through hole 16 is formed in the left side surface of the garbage collection box 12, and a sealing baffle 17 extending to the rear inner wall of the through hole 16 is inserted in the front surface of the garbage collection box 12 in a sliding manner; through the technical scheme, when the garbage in the garbage collection box 12 needs to be subjected to centralized treatment, the sealing baffle 17 is arranged, so that a worker can conveniently take out the sealing baffle 17, and the garbage cleaning effect can be realized.
Further, the inner bottom wall of the garbage collection box 12 is inclined, a drain hole 18 is formed between the filter box 1 and the garbage collection box 12, and the drain hole 18 is positioned below the discharge hole 13; through above-mentioned technical scheme, the sewage that leaves rubbish leads, makes it flow back again to in the rose box 1, realizes multiple filterable effect by prior art's quartz sand layer and follow-up other sewage treatment structure again.
Through setting up rubbish circulation collection device, can realize realizing the effect of automatic cycle clearance to the rubbish on the grid 4, and follow-up staff when unifying the clearance to rubbish, realize making the grid 4 that is located rose box 1 still can be in normal operating condition, can not receive the effect of influence, compare with prior art, have simple structure, operation swiftly, with low costs and the practicality advantage that is strong.
The implementation principle of the continuous sewage treatment device applied to the rural water environment treatment in the embodiment of the application is as follows: step one, a quartz sand layer in the prior art is arranged below a drain hole 18 in a filter box 1, and is used for filtering sewage flowing down from a grating 4 and the drain hole 18;
step two, control driving motor 5 to start, driving motor 5 drives driving rod 8 and the action wheel on driving rod 8 surface and realizes circular motion, drive from the driving wheel and from the driven rod 9 rotation of driving wheel wall connection through drive belt 6, and then carry out the circulation promotion to the bin outlet 13 direction through the rubbish that scraper 7 that drive belt 6 surface set up is detained on grid 4 surface, rethread bin outlet 13 drops to rubbish collecting box 12 in, drain off rubbish that is located rubbish collecting box 12 through set up drain board 15 in rubbish collecting box 12, thereby make things convenient for the staff to only need to pull open the seal baffle 17 that is located rubbish collecting box 12 one side, can unify the clearance to rubbish, and in the clearance process, the grid 4 that is located filter box 1 still can be in normal operating condition.
